A search for the ξ(2230) resonance in the bar p p → KsKs channel at LEAR [Low Energy Antiproton Ring]

Description

Seventeen measurements of differential and total cross sections of the bar pp → KsKs reaction in the antiproton momentum range of 1.30 GeV/c to 1.57 GeV/c are presented. Most of these measurements are centered around the mass of the ξ(2230) resonance first seen in the K+K- and KsKs channel of the radiative decay of the J/Ψ by the MARK III collaboration at SLAC. The trajectories of the charged decay products of the Ks particles are recorded by two stacks of drift chambers and a set of plastic streamer tube planes. The bar pp → KsKs → π+π-π+π- events are reconstructed by a computer program and undergo a full kinematic fitting. A branching ratio upper limit, BR(bar pp → ξ)·BR(ξ → KsKs), on the presence of the resonance is calculated. The experiment was performed by the PS185 collaboration at the Low Energy Antiproton Ring (LEAR) at CERN
